Rovers to keep Shotton for further month
Tranmere Rovers have today extended the loan spell of defender Ryan Shotton for a further month after an impressive first month in the white shirt.

Shotton, who is on loan at Tranmere from Premier League new boys Stoke City, has already become a firm hit with the fans at Prenton Park, where his defensive brilliance and goal scoring ability has firmly secured his place in the Tranmere team at the moment, ahead of fellow defenders Gareth Edds, Godwin Antwi and Danny Holmes.

Joining Tranmere at the end of August, Shotton has so far started five games for Tranmere and scored two goals, the vital winner away at Huddersfield and a 30-yard screamer against Colchester United.

The player, who has so far been selected in the League One team of the week twice since joining the club, will now be at Prenton Park until at least the end of October.
